Pedro is passionate about higher business education, with a career of more than 25 years in public, private and non-profit institutions. This experience has given him a unique understanding of business and a comprehensive perspective of the world in which they operate, making it easier for leaders and organizations to thrive in their business ecosystem. At the beginning of his professional life, Pedro collaborated in the promotion of investment projects of foreign companies in our country. Through the Tecnológico de Monterrey, he has participated as a consultant in the Institute of Family Businesses, the Eugenio Garza Lagüera Entrepreneurship Institute, the Award for the Best Mexican Companies awarded jointly with Deloitte and Citibanamex, and Executive Education at EGADE Business School. His teaching and research activities focus on innovative entrepreneurship. His most recent publications address the creation of new companies and the growth aspirations of Mexican entrepreneurs, mainly based on data from the Global Entrepreneurship Monitor (GEM) project. Likewise, he actively participates in different national and international forums that promote the entrepreneurial mentality. He is currently a member of the Academic Senate of Tecnológico de Monterrey and Chapter Advisor of Beta Gamma Sigma.

He is currently the director of the MBA program at EGADE Business School in Monterrey and Guadalajara.

Dr. Ibarra-Yunez’s areas of specialization are international trade and finance, economic models, industrial organization and regulations, econometrics, the Latin American economy, trade blocks and commercial agreements. In recent years, his research has been based in the areas of imperfect contracts in international integration, moral hazard problems, game theory and network sectors (telecommunications, infrastructure, transport, energy, banking, and multinational outsourcing.)

His deep knowledge of networks and regulation has earned him the positions of Director of the network economies and economic regulation at Tecnológico de Monterrey, of the Graduate Center for Studies of Western Hemispheric Trade at the University of Texas at Austin (USA) - where he has also worked as Professor of International Integration and Economic Problems and Policies of Latin America since 1994. He also and the Economic and Regulatory Challenges and Opportunities for U.S.-Mexico Electricity Trade and Cooperation project at the LBJ School of Public Affairs – an institution where he has also been a visiting professor.

He has published 11 books and more than 40 articles in scientific journals related to his area of research. Additionally, he is an international consultant in the areas of industrial organization and regulation, as well as international trade and network regulation. Dr. Ibarra-Yunez is also a member of SNI (Sistema Nacional de Investigadores) Level II, Conacyt.

Dr. Prasad’s research encompasses the areas of entrepreneurship, gender, and diversity in organizations and interpretive methods, topics he addresses from diverse theoretical-critical perspectives. His publications have taken poststructural, postmodern, feminist, postcolonial, neo-Marxist, and psychoanalytical approaches. He is co-chair of the Critical Management Studies division at the Academy of Management.

Dr. Prasad is the Leader of the Research Group (GI) in Leadership and Effective and Efficient Organizations at the Tecnológico de Monterrey Business School. He has published over 50 articles and chapters, which include at least 20 contributions to scientific journals such as Q1, including Academy of Management Learning and Education, Advances in Consumer Research, Business & Society, Critical Perspectives on Accounting, Gender, Work and Organization, Human Relations, Industrial and Organizational Psychology, International Journal of Cross-Cultural Management, as well as the Journal of Business Ethics and Critical Perspectives on International Business, for which he has also co-edited special issues. He is also a member of the editorial Human Relations committees and the International Journal of Entrepreneurial Behavior and Research. Emerald published his first book.

To date, Dr. Prasad has been the beneficiary of $15,000,000 USD in research funding, including grants and awards from national financial institutions, such as the British Academy (United Kingdom), The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council (Canada), and Conacyt (Mexico). At 31, he was admitted as the youngest SNI Conacyt program level II member.

Dr. Prasad wrote much of his doctoral thesis as a graduate researcher at Yale University. His doctoral research was funded by a grant from the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council and several other awards. He has taught MBA and doctoral program courses and supervised research students at the master's and doctorate levels. Before arriving at the EGADE Business School, Dr. Prasad was head teacher at the UNSW Business School (incorporated into the AGSM). He has also held research positions at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em and Rutgers University.
